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Learn Exploring Docker Hub and Downloading Images | Working with Docker Images
Docker Essentials

bookExploring Docker Hub and Downloading Images

Introduction to Docker Hub

Docker Hub is the primary online repository where you can find, share, and manage Docker images. It serves as a central hub that connects the global Docker community, enabling you to access a vast collection of pre-built images for operating systems, databases, application runtimes, and more. By leveraging Docker Hub, you can quickly get started with popular technologies without needing to build images from scratch. This not only saves time but also ensures you are using well-maintained and frequently updated images provided by trusted sources.

Key benefits of Docker Hub:

  • Provides access to thousands of ready-to-use images;
  • Connects you with trusted publishers and the broader Docker community;
  • Offers official images that are regularly updated and security-checked;
  • Helps you avoid building and maintaining images for common software.

Docker Hub is an essential resource for any Docker user, making it easy to launch and manage containers with reliable, up-to-date images.

Searching for Official Images on Docker Hub

To make the most of Docker Hub, you need to know how to search for and identify official images.

  • Visit the Docker Hub website at https://hub.docker.com;
  • Use the search bar at the top to enter the name of the software or service you are interested in, such as nginx, mysql, or python;
  • Official images are maintained by Docker or the upstream software maintainers and are marked with a blue Official badge;
  • Official images have concise names, such as nginx instead of someuser/nginx;
  • These images come with detailed documentation and usage instructions;
  • When choosing an image, check the number of downloads, the description, and the update frequency to ensure you are selecting a reliable and secure option.

Official images provide a trusted starting point for your projects and help you avoid unnecessary security risks.

Downloading Images

To download a Docker image from Docker Hub to your local computer, use the docker pull command. This command retrieves the specified image and stores it in your local Docker environment, allowing you to create containers from it instantly.

How to use docker pull:

  • Open your terminal or command prompt;
  • Type docker pull followed by the image name, such as docker pull nginx.

Examples:

  • Download the latest official Nginx image:
    docker pull nginx
    

After running the command, the image appears in your local image list. You can view all downloaded images using docker images.

question mark

What is Docker Hub primarily used for?

Select the correct answer

Everything was clear?

How can we improve it?

Thanks for your feedback!

SectionΒ 2. ChapterΒ 1

Ask AI

expand

Ask AI

ChatGPT

Ask anything or try one of the suggested questions to begin our chat

Suggested prompts:

How do I create a Docker Hub account?

Can you explain the difference between official and community images?

What are some best practices for using Docker Hub securely?

Awesome!

Completion rate improved to 7.14

bookExploring Docker Hub and Downloading Images

Swipe to show menu

Introduction to Docker Hub

Docker Hub is the primary online repository where you can find, share, and manage Docker images. It serves as a central hub that connects the global Docker community, enabling you to access a vast collection of pre-built images for operating systems, databases, application runtimes, and more. By leveraging Docker Hub, you can quickly get started with popular technologies without needing to build images from scratch. This not only saves time but also ensures you are using well-maintained and frequently updated images provided by trusted sources.

Key benefits of Docker Hub:

  • Provides access to thousands of ready-to-use images;
  • Connects you with trusted publishers and the broader Docker community;
  • Offers official images that are regularly updated and security-checked;
  • Helps you avoid building and maintaining images for common software.

Docker Hub is an essential resource for any Docker user, making it easy to launch and manage containers with reliable, up-to-date images.

Searching for Official Images on Docker Hub

To make the most of Docker Hub, you need to know how to search for and identify official images.

  • Visit the Docker Hub website at https://hub.docker.com;
  • Use the search bar at the top to enter the name of the software or service you are interested in, such as nginx, mysql, or python;
  • Official images are maintained by Docker or the upstream software maintainers and are marked with a blue Official badge;
  • Official images have concise names, such as nginx instead of someuser/nginx;
  • These images come with detailed documentation and usage instructions;
  • When choosing an image, check the number of downloads, the description, and the update frequency to ensure you are selecting a reliable and secure option.

Official images provide a trusted starting point for your projects and help you avoid unnecessary security risks.

Downloading Images

To download a Docker image from Docker Hub to your local computer, use the docker pull command. This command retrieves the specified image and stores it in your local Docker environment, allowing you to create containers from it instantly.

How to use docker pull:

  • Open your terminal or command prompt;
  • Type docker pull followed by the image name, such as docker pull nginx.

Examples:

  • Download the latest official Nginx image:
    docker pull nginx
    

After running the command, the image appears in your local image list. You can view all downloaded images using docker images.

question mark

What is Docker Hub primarily used for?

Select the correct answer

Everything was clear?

How can we improve it?

Thanks for your feedback!

SectionΒ 2. ChapterΒ 1
some-alt